I have a HR34 with a Sony Bravia HDTV attached to it via HDMI. I just bought a LG 3D TV for my basement. I figure my best bet is to split from the HR34 and have a short run to the Sony and about a 50ft run to the LG. I don't mind having the same picture on both as neither will be on at the same time.

My question has to do with the 3D. I know HDMI cables support 3D and the splitter I buy from monoprice will also support 3D, sooooo is it just that simple? Can I get 3D programming downstairs and 2D upstairs? Am I missing something?
 
Wow, thanks for the quick reply. If I go with a switch, then there is no way to watch both TVs at once with the same program, correct? Where as a splitter you have that option.

If i did install a switch, can I watch live programming downstairs and a recorded show from the HR34 upstairs? I am assuming no from my limited knowledge because once I switch the signal downstairs, there is nothing going to the Bravia.
 
No you would not, you can try the splitter, I have one with my Dish sub and it has issues sometimes where I have to unplug one or the other sets for it to work in the other room.( I mainly watch DIRECTV in that room, it's one of my 3D sets)
 
your best option would be to get a client and put at the other location, but another option without going through a splitter or switch, would be at main tv to use component cables to go from receiver to tv, then the mirrored tv to use the long hdmi.
